A Reliable Wife by Robert Goolrick

This source presents excerpts from Robert Goolrick's novel, "A Reliable Wife." The narrative follows Ralph Truitt, a wealthy man in Wisconsin in 1907, who advertises for a wife after experiencing profound personal loss and loneliness. He awaits the arrival of Catherine Land from Chicago, who has her own complex past and motivations. The text explores their initial meeting during a snowstorm, a dramatic carriage accident, and Catherine's efforts to nurse Ralph back to health while harboring secrets and a specific plan related to his estranged son, Antonio Moretti. The story follows their complex relationship, revealing their pasts, desires, and the dark secrets that complicate their future, ultimately focusing on themes of loneliness, desperation, deception, and the possibility of redemption.
